I have several versions of netbeans installed in Ubuntu 12.04. When I
open the dash and type "Net", Netbeans 7.1 is the first search result
under applications. However, when I proceed to type "NetB" , "netb", or
"Netb" the result disappears. It seems that the application is
registered as "Net Beans". If I type "Net Beans" with a space it works
fine. Normally I would assume that this is a problem with the given
application, however, in the dash, the application is displayed as
"NetBeans IDE 7.1". I would think that if I type in that exact name, it
should appear in the search results, but it doesn't.
In Summary:
Netbeans IDE is labled "NetBeans IDE 7.1" in the dash, but typing "NetBeans"
into the dash will not display netbeans while typing "Net Beans" will. This is
quite confusing and not intuitive. If dash lables a program as xxx typing xxx
should result in the program being matching in the search results.
